BIG 10
Offensive Co-Players of the Week
Taylor Martinez, Nebraska
Jr., QB, Corona, Calif./Centennial
• Guided the Huskers on two fourth-quarter scoring drives, erasing a 10-point deficit in the final frame for a 28-24 victory over Michigan State on Saturday
• Ran for 205 yards, the seventh 200-yard rushing performance in the Big Ten this season, and touchdown runs of 35 and 71 yards
• Passed for 160 yards, resulting in 365 yards of total offense, and two touchdowns, including the game winner with six seconds remaining
• Wins his fifth career Big Ten Offensive Player of the Week award and fourth this season, tied for second most in a single season in conference history
Cody Latimer, Indiana
So., WR, Dayton, Ohio/Jefferson Township
• Set or matched career highs in catches, yards and receiving touchdowns to help Indiana to a 24-21 victory over Iowa on Saturday
• Accounted for all three Hoosier touchdowns, hauling in three scoring passes, which is tied for the second most in a single game in program history
• Caught seven passes for 113 yards, including receptions of six, 15 and 30 yards that resulted in scores, the latter being the game winner
